Abstract

India is the second largest country in the world having more than 1.3 billion people, in which most of the people are depending on agriculture resources. In India, our state Tamilnadu is also contributes to the national agricultural products such as paddy, maize, sugarcane, turmeric, etc. The most wanted and the important crop grown in Tamilnadu is Paddy. Cauvery Delta Zone in Tamilnadu is the major contributor in the production of paddy. This Zone covers the districts such as Thanjavur, Tiruvarur, Nagappattinam, Pudukottai, Cuddalore, Ariyalur, Karur and Tiruchirappalli. Most of the people in these districts are dependent on the cultivation and the yield of paddy. Increasing the yield of the paddy crop in these districts is expected to have a significant impact on the economy of both the farmers and the nation on a whole. This increase in crop yield will promote sustainable agriculture which will result in attaining a sustainable development of our nation. Performing a precise prediction about the crop yield could help the farmers take necessary steps to improve their yield in future and get economical benefits out of it. Among the various prediction models that have been developed in the literature, there are only a limited number of models that exists to forecast the yield of paddy. Hence, a Deep Learning based yield prediction model has been proposed to forecast the yield of paddy in the Cauvery Delta zone which is the major contributor of the production of these crops. Here, Long Short Term Memory (LSTM) has been used to build the prediction model.
